  1. 1 Whether there was an error apparent on the record regarding the timing of payment of terminal benefits to the plaintiff.
  2. 2 Whether the plaintiff is entitled to costs and interest despite prior payment of terminal benefits.

Ratio Decidendi

The court found that there was an error apparent on the record in its earlier order, as the terminal benefits were paid to the plaintiff only after the suit had been filed, not before. The defendant executed a general bank guarantee and made payment in March 2004, while the suit was filed in December 2003. Therefore, the plaintiff was entitled to costs of the suit and interest from the date of filing to the date of payment. The previous order was reviewed and amended to reflect this correction.

Court Disposition

application for review allowed; previous order reviewed and amended

Orders

  • The order of 21st June 2005 is reviewed and amended to state that the defendant executed a general bank guarantee after the suit was filed.
  • The plaintiff is entitled to costs of the suit plus interest from the date of filing to the date of payment.
